In the Spanish Grand Prix at the Circuit de Catalunya today, Nico Rosberg delivered the best performance of his Formula One career to date as he crossed the finish line in sixth position. Nico’s three points drive him up one place in the Drivers’ table to eighth, while the team move into equal fifth place in the Constructors’ Championship.
However, the Grand Prix brought a split result for the team as Alex Wurz’s frustrating weekend continued into the race as a collision forced him into early retirement at the end of the first lap. With Monaco the next stop on the calendar in two weeks’ time, the pressure to find additional performance remains and so the team will spend four days testing at the Paul Ricard facility in France this week.
